Re: Steering Wheel Nut
And for fellow tool fetishists the correct size socket/box spanner is 3/4 Whitworth for Minor 1000 & 7/8 Whitworth for MM/S11

Re: The difference between mm and series 2
Late 52/early 53 was the crossover between MM & S11s - lots of cars have since had engines, grilles & badges changed etc - the only real way to tell is by the chassis no - if the prefix is SMM then it is a Series MM & if the prefix is FA or FB then it is a Series 11.
